Substrate utilization in defined media for two flower spiroplasmas (S. floricola and FS SR-3) and honeybee spiroplasma (HBS AS-576) was investigated. Glucose, fructose, and mannose were utilized by all three spiroplasmas. In addition, HBS (AS-576) could ferment trehalose; FS (SR-3), sucrose; and S. floricola, trehalose, sucrose, and raffinose. Improvements in in vitro maturation techniques have focused on culture optimization to increase oocyte maturation rates. Specialized culture media, now commercially available, did not perform significantly better than standard IVF culture media for maturation of immature oocytes in our normal IVF cases.
